E0044: r##"
You can't use type parameters on foreign items. Example of erroneous code:
```
extern { fn some_func<T>(x: T); }
```
To fix this, replace the type parameter with the specializations that you
need:
```
extern { fn some_func_i32(x: i32); }
extern { fn some_func_i64(x: i64); }
```

E0071: r##"
You tried to use a structure initialization with a non-structure type.
Example of erroneous code:
```
enum Foo { FirstValue };
let u = Foo::FirstValue { value: 0i32 }; // error: Foo::FirstValue
// isn't a structure!
// or even simpler, if the structure wasn't defined at all:
let u = RandomName { random_field: 0i32 }; // error: RandomName
// isn't a structure!
```
To fix this, please check:
* Did you spell it right?
* Did you accidentaly used an enum as a struct?
* Did you accidentaly make an enum when you intended to use a struct?
Here is the previous code with all missing information:
```
struct Inner {
value: i32
}
enum Foo {
FirstValue(Inner)
}
fn main() {
let u = Foo::FirstValue(Inner { value: 0i32 });
let t = Inner { value: 0i32 };
}
```
